I. POSITION OBJECTIVE

The Administrator for the Olefins 3 unit oversees and coordinates plantwide transactions with various departments, including Accounting, Texas GMO, ISC, NJ PSM and Purchasing (both local and NJ) ensuring seamless collaboration and operational alignment. The Administrator is responsible for maintaining a safe and complaint working environment that adheres to all environmental, health, and safety regulatory and company standards. Additionally, this role involves managing and organizing critical documentation required to support continuous production, ensuring the smooth and uninterrupted operation of the facility.

II. MAJOR AREAS OF ACCOUNTABILITY 

Project Management Support - Take ownership of planning, coordinating, and overseeing projects for the Olefins 3 production unit. Independently track project progress, and implement solutions to ensure timely execution. Act as primary point of contact for management and employees, delivering regular updates and recommendations to align projects with strategic goals.

Project Cost Analysis - Lead efforts to analyze and control expenditures for the Olefins 3 unit, leveraging monthly cost analysis reports to identify deviations and inefficiencies. Collaborate with management to define budgetary requirements, and ensure alignment with financial objectives.

KPI Tracking - Monitor, analyze, and develop reports to assist the Olefins 3 unit in maintaining the proper assignments and ratios of assigned MOC’s, recommendation reports, B1 projects, and actions to ensure nothing is overdue. Coordinate between the various departments (Operations, Maintenance, PSM, and E&HS) and act as department liaison with aforementioned departments.

Policy Compliance - Serve as an advocate of company policy, ensuring adherence to ISO standards and compliance with regulatory, quality, environmental, health, and safety requirements. Take the lead in identifying and addressing compliance gaps, collaborating with employees to resolve issues efficiently. Oversee controlled document management to maintain conformity with company and regulatory standards.

Census Governance - In conjunction with NJ Accounting and Departmental Management team, analysis and monitoring of census accuracy in accordance with MCA Approved Census/Organizational Charts total on a quarterly/yearly basis.

THM - Promote cleanliness and order through implementation of the Total house Keeping Maintenance Program. Emphasize Nothing Touch Ground program and No Visual Pollution program. Maintain the plant in like new conditions.

III. QUALIFICATIONS

TECHNICAL JOB CRITERIA

1. Previous Related Experience Required:

A minimum of one (1) to five (5) years of experience in invoice processing/auditing, in a Petrochemical facility, depending on education.

2. Technical Skills Required To Perform This Job

  • Knowledge of MS Word, Excel, PowerPoint, and Outlook, preferred
  • Knowledge of AS400, ERP Websmart, FPC/MCA workflow system
  • Experience with contract setup/execution
  • Basic problem-solving skills

3. Education (Minimal Education Needed)

High School Diploma or Equivalent plus a minimum of five (5) years of experience in in invoice processing/auditing, in a Petrochemical facility, or an Associate Degree with three (3) years of experience in invoice processing/auditing, in a Petrochemical facility, or a Bachelor’s Degree with a minimum of one (1) year of experience in invoice processing/auditing, in a Petrochemical facility, preferred.
